13- (b)- atomic number,atomic masses

not all atoms of an element are identical-atoms of the same element can have different number of neutron. these different versions of the same elements are called isotopes.

isotopes are atoms with same number of proton but have a different number of neutrons.since the atomic number is equal to the numbers of protons and the atomic mass is the sum of protons and neutron.

15-(d) all of the above are correct

hydrogen bond is a not a covalent or ionic bond it is just a weak bond between two molecules resulting from an electrostatic attarction between a proton in one molecule and an electronegative atom in the other.

in liquid state the molecules of water are held together by hydrogen bond as the liquid state changes into gas the bond disapper as in the gaseous state distance between the molecule gets increases.

20- ions

ions forms when atom gain or lose electron. since their is change is neutrality of atom as a result charge develop upon it. if a atom recives a electron so the element becomes negatively cherged or if it losses electron it will become positive.

ions are of two types i cations- positively charged species. ii-anions - negatively charged species.
